Leetonia-Leonard Paul DiLudovico, 98, of Leetonia, passed away on Saturday, April 20, 2019, at the Salem Regional Medical Center.
Mr. DiLudovico was born January 31, 1921 in San Pietro Avellana, Italy and immigrated, along with his family, to the United States when he was nine years old. He is the son of the late Joseph and Zilda DiCianno DiLudovico.
He had served in the U.S. Army as a medic in the Pacific Theater during WWII. He was employed as a machinist for the former Mullins Manufacturing in Salem for 31 years and later worked in the Maintenance Department for Salem Schools. He was a member of St. Patrick’s Catholic Church, Leetonia and a life member of Joe Williams Post #131 American Legion. Leonard loved the outdoors, his garden, and could fix just about anything. He also enjoyed refurbishing tractors and loved to bake pizza and bread to share with his friends.
His wife, the former Margaret Stepanian, whom he married October 3, 1964, preceded him in death on April 21, 2016.
